This 159.9-mile drive from Solvang, CA to Santa Ana, CA is designed for a single day, taking approximately 3 hours and 18 minutes. You'll primarily navigate the Ventura Freeway and Santa Ana Freeway, with a portion on Chumash Highway, making it a largely highway-focused experience. With a projected fuel cost of around $37, this route is an economical option for a quick trip between the Pacific Coast regions. The drive is manageable enough to complete in one go, allowing for flexibility in your schedule. Expect a straightforward journey with minimal need for overnight stops.

Expect a predominantly highway-focused drive, with 69% of the journey on major freeways. The longest uninterrupted stretch you'll encounter is 70.5 miles along the Ventura Freeway, offering a consistent pace. While much of this route utilizes high-speed transit, the character can shift slightly as you transition between named freeways, such as the Ventura and Santa Ana Freeways. Overall, this drive prioritizes efficient travel over winding scenic byways, providing a predictable driving experience for much of its length.
This is a straightforward highway drive that stays mostly on Ventura Freeway and Santa Ana Freeway. This route has several spots where lane changes, forks, or exits need your full attention. The trickiest moment comes around 5 miles in near CA 154 / Chumash Highway.

| Road | Distance | Duration |
|---|---|---|
| Ventura Freeway | 70.5 mi | 1h 21m |
| Santa Ana Freeway | 29.6 mi | 35m |
| Chumash Highway | 23.9 mi | 32m |
| El Camino Real | 17 mi | 19m |
| Hollywood Freeway | 10.3 mi | 14m |
| Mission Drive | 4.9 mi | 8m |
| North Broadway | 1.3 mi | 2m |
| Route 101 | 0.6 mi | <1m |
